Common Lawn Sprinkler Head Issues

Sprinkler heads can face a variety of typical concerns that impact their efficiency. One constant problem is obstructing, which occurs when mineral, debris, or dirt build-up blocks the nozzle. To repair this, you can remove the head and clean it extensively. Another issue is inappropriate positioning; heads might obtain knocked out of setting, bring about uneven watering. You can adjust them back to their appropriate angles to assure proper coverage. Furthermore, fractured or broken heads can cause leaks and reduced pressure. If you detect any damage, change the head promptly. Sometimes, the pop-up mechanism can malfunction, causing the head to remain stuck. In such cases, look for any debris or damage in the device. Normal upkeep and inspections can help you catch these problems early, maintaining your lawn sprinkler running efficiently and effectively.

Inspect Water Pressure Problems

A number of elements can add to water pressure issues in your sprinkler system, bring about unequal circulation. First, inspect your water resource. Reduced municipal stress or a partially closed shutoff can impact flow. Next, evaluate for clogs in your pipelines or lawn sprinkler heads; dust and particles can obstruct water flow. In addition, look for leakages in your system, as they can significantly decrease pressure. If you've obtained a pressure regulator, verify it's operating appropriately, as a breakdown can cause irregular stress across areas. Ultimately, you could require to change your system design, particularly if you have actually added new heads or areas. By identifying and dealing with these problems, you'll enhance water distribution and keep your landscape healthy and balanced.

Fixing Malfunctioning Valves

When your lawn sprinkler system's shutoffs start to malfunction, it can interrupt your entire watering arrangement, resulting in dry spots in your yard or overwatering in some locations. To tackle this problem, first, find the valve that's triggering problems. Look for noticeable signs of damage, like splits or leaks. If the valve appears stuck, you can delicately touch it to see if it maximizes.

Following, switch off the water supply and dismantle the shutoff to examine its internal parts. Seek dirt or particles that could be obstructing its operation. Tidy the elements with water and a brush, and change any kind of damaged parts, such as seals or diaphragms.

After rebuilding, turn the water back on and examine the valve. See to it it's opening and shutting correctly. Consider changing the entire shutoff to restore your system's effectiveness. if it still doesn't operate.

How Usually Should I Evaluate My Sprinkler System?

You should inspect your sprinkler system at the very least twice a year, preferably in springtime and fall. Regular checks aid determine leakages, blockages, or broken components, guaranteeing your system functions efficiently and keeps your landscape healthy.

Can I Winterize My Sprinkler System Myself?

Yes, you can winterize your automatic Sprinkler tune-up sprinkler on your own. Just drain pipes the pipes, impact out the lines with an air compressor, and protect exposed parts. It's a straightforward procedure that'll shield your system from freezing damages.

What Tools Do I Required for Sprinkler Repairs?

For sprinkler repairs, you'll need a couple of necessary tools: a wrench, pliers, a screwdriver collection, Teflon tape, and an utility knife. Having these accessible makes taking care of leaks or replacing parts a lot simpler.
